Webb7 okt. 2024 · If Kelsey’s company offers 80 hours of PTO a year, then the calculation will look like this. 80 Hours of PTO ÷ 2,000 total work hours = 0.04 PTO hours accrued per hour worked. For every hour Kelsey works, she will receive 0.04 hours of paid time off. Many businesses see this as the fairest way to assign PTO. 3. WebbMinimum Requirements: An employee starts to accrue vacation entitlement after five days of employment. Employees are entitled to 10 working days vacation per year in B.C. After five years of employment your employees are entitled to 15 working days vacation in B.C. An employer can agree to more vacation, but not less. Webb10 nov. 2024 · Under Japan’s labour laws, all full time employees are guaranteed the minimum 10 days of paid annual leave per year after serving an initial 6 months of employment, irrespective of race or gender, and where they were present for at least 80% of the hours they were supposed to be working.
